What is fleet management software?

Fleet management software is a cloud-based system that collects data from your vehicles — usually through a small telematics device or an OBD-II plug — and turns it into decisions you can act on. Instead of wondering where a van is, whether a driver is speeding, or when a truck is due for service, you see all of it in real time. For small businesses the value is concentrated in six areas: location visibility, routing, fuel, maintenance, safety, and regulatory compliance.

Core features that matter for a small fleet

Vendors advertise dozens of features. For a fleet of 5–50 vehicles, these are the six that deliver almost all of the return.

1. Real-time GPS tracking

Live location for every vehicle on one map is the foundation. It ends “Where are you?” phone calls, gives customers accurate arrival windows, and creates an audit trail for disputes. Look for updates at least every 30 seconds, historical route replay, and mobile access so you can check the fleet from your phone.

2. Route optimization

Manually sequencing stops is where small fleets quietly lose money. Automated route optimization orders stops to minimize miles and time, factoring in traffic and time windows. Fleets typically cut 15–25% of fuel spend this way. We cover the mechanics in AI-powered route optimization for small fleets.

3. Fuel monitoring

Fuel is usually the single largest variable cost in a fleet. Software flags excessive idling, inefficient routes, and unusual fuel-card spend that often signals theft. Our dedicated guide, how to reduce fleet fuel costs, breaks down the specific levers.

4. Preventive maintenance

Reactive repairs cost far more than scheduled service and pull vehicles off the road at the worst times. A maintenance module schedules service by mileage or engine hours and warns you before a part fails. See building a preventive maintenance schedule for a ready-to-use interval table.

5. Driver safety monitoring

Harsh braking, rapid acceleration, speeding, and idling are the behaviors that drive up fuel, wear, and insurance costs. Safety scoring turns those events into a per-driver number you can coach against. Start with driver safety scoring best practices and formalize it with a driver safety training program.

6. Compliance (ELD, HOS, DVIR, IFTA)

If you run commercial vehicles, compliance is non-negotiable. Modern platforms automate Hours-of-Service logs, electronic logging device (ELD) records, driver vehicle inspection reports (DVIR), and IFTA fuel-tax reporting — replacing paper and reducing the risk of fines. The business case: what small fleets actually save

The return on fleet software comes from four stacking savings:

  • Fuel: 15–25% reduction from route optimization, idle reduction, and behavior coaching.
  • Maintenance: up to 30% lower repair costs by shifting from reactive to preventive service.
  • Insurance: safer driving scores and dashcam evidence frequently earn premium reductions.
  • Labor: automated routing, logs, and reporting remove hours of administrative work every week.

For a 10-vehicle fleet, fuel savings alone usually cover the software cost several times over. The practical test: add up your monthly fuel and repair spend, and a 15% improvement is a conservative target once the system is running.

What fleet management software costs

Small-fleet platforms are priced per vehicle per month, typically between $15 and $40 depending on features and whether hardware is included. Watch for three hidden costs: hardware fees, long contract lock-ins, and paid add-ons for features (like ELD or dashcams) that should be standard. A fair small-business plan bundles the core modules and bills monthly. If a quote requires a sales call just to see a number, treat that as a signal.

Implementing fleet software in your first 30 days

  1. Week 1 — Install & verify: plug in devices, confirm every vehicle reports location, and add drivers.
  2. Week 2 — Baseline: let data collect. Record current fuel spend, idle time, and average miles per route so you can measure improvement.
  3. Week 3 — Optimize: turn on route optimization, set maintenance intervals, and configure geofences for your key sites.
  4. Week 4 — Coach: review driver safety scores with your team and set targets. Small, consistent coaching produces the biggest behavior change.

By the end of month one you should have a measurable baseline and the first fuel and safety improvements showing up in the data.

Fleet management software vs. standalone GPS trackers

Many small operators start with a cheap GPS tracker and assume it is "fleet software." It is not. A basic tracker shows a dot on a map; fleet management software turns that location data into routing, maintenance, safety, and compliance decisions. The difference shows up on your P&L: a tracker tells you where a van is, but a full platform tells you the van is due for service in 400 miles, that its driver braked hard six times yesterday, and that reordering its stops would save 40 miles tomorrow. For a fleet of 5–50 vehicles, the incremental cost of a full platform over a bare tracker is small, and the modules it adds — maintenance and compliance in particular — are exactly the ones that prevent the most expensive problems.

Signs your small business has outgrown spreadsheets

Most small fleets do not decide to buy software on a whim — they hit a breaking point. The common signals: you cannot answer "where is that vehicle right now?" without a phone call; a truck breaks down because a service interval slipped through a spreadsheet; fuel spend keeps climbing and no one can say why; a compliance deadline (ELD, IFTA, DVIR) sneaks up; or you are spending several hours a week just reconciling logs and receipts by hand. Any two of these together usually means manual tracking is already costing more than software would.

Fleet management KPIs every small operator should track

Once the software is in place, a handful of metrics tell you whether the fleet is healthy and whether the tool is paying off:

  • Cost per mile: total operating cost divided by miles driven — the single best measure of fleet efficiency over time.
  • Vehicle availability (uptime): the percentage of time each vehicle is ready to work rather than sidelined for repairs. Preventive maintenance is what protects this number.
  • Preventive maintenance compliance: the share of scheduled services completed on time. Low compliance predicts breakdowns.
  • Fuel efficiency (MPG) and idle percentage: track both per vehicle and per driver to find outliers.
  • Driver safety score: harsh events per 100 miles, trended month over month.
  • On-time delivery / service rate: the customer-facing metric routing improvements should move.

A good platform surfaces these on one dashboard so you are managing by exception — looking at the vehicles and drivers that fall outside your targets rather than reviewing everything manually.

Data security and driver privacy

Because fleet software collects continuous location and behavior data, treat security and privacy as selection criteria, not afterthoughts. Confirm the vendor encrypts data in transit and at rest, offers role-based access so a dispatcher and an owner see different views, and lets you set clear boundaries on personal-use vehicles. Being transparent with drivers about what is tracked and why — and limiting monitoring to working hours where appropriate — both keeps you compliant and preserves the trust that makes safety coaching work. A reputable small-fleet platform makes these controls straightforward rather than burying them.

Fleet software and electric vehicles

Small fleets are increasingly adding electric vans and trucks, and the software requirements shift when they do. Instead of fuel monitoring you need state-of-charge tracking, charging-station planning, and range-aware routing so a vehicle is never dispatched on a route it cannot complete. If EVs are on your roadmap in the next few years, confirm the platform already reports battery and charging data rather than bolting it on later. Even in a mixed fleet, the core value — routing, maintenance, safety, compliance — is identical; only the fuel/energy module changes.

Getting your whole team on board

Software only delivers savings if the people using it adopt it. The owner sees the ROI, but drivers and dispatchers live in the tool day to day, so bring them in early. Frame tracking and scoring as protection and coaching rather than surveillance, show drivers the mobile app that benefits them (clearer routes, proof of on-time arrivals, fewer disputed timecards), and give your dispatcher or office manager a short walkthrough of the reports they will own. Assign one person to be the weekly "data owner" who reviews the dashboard and flags exceptions — without that single point of accountability, even the best platform quietly goes unused. Adoption, not features, is what separates fleets that see the full 15–25% savings from those that pay for software and change nothing.
